Abstract

•Coupled mechanical and control system equations are expressed in second-order form.•n-Space eigensolvers can be used without damping and steady-state error elimination.•2n eigensolvers can be used with damping.•New 3n eigensolver method allows for both damping and steady-state error elimination.

A method for performing modal analysis of undamped active flexible multibody systems with collocated sensors and actuators in a finite element environment was recently developed by the authors. In this paper, the theory is further expanded to include systems with non-collocated sensors and actuators, damping and steady-state error elimination. The closed-loop eigenvalue problem for active flexible multibody systems with multiple-input multiple-output proportional-integral-derivative (PID) feedback type controllers and multiple degrees of freedom finite element models is solved.
